Toggle navigation
Home
World
UNITED KINGDOM
VAUXHALL
UNITED KINGDOM
VAUXHALL
UNITED KINGDOM (VAUXHALL)
6
PLACE OF WORSHIP in VAUXHALL
5
AUTO SERVICE & MAINTENANCE in VAUXHALL
3
NIGHTLIFE in VAUXHALL
1
TRAIN STATION in VAUXHALL
1
PETROL/GASOLINE STATION in VAUXHALL
1
SPORTS CENTRE in VAUXHALL